Job description
Programme Planning and Implementation
  • Develop and implement Outreach plan/follow-up visits to seniors in the identified blocks.
  • Develop and implement annual calendar plan of social and health activities for seniors.
  • Ensure that the programmes and activities meet the performance indicators and operating guidelines issued by MOH, AIC, or MSF via their reporting systems, etc.
  • Establish and motivate seniors to run mutual help groups.
  • To conduct regular outreach to the seniors in identified HDB blocks/Private residences with the aim of registering all seniors within its service boundary and carry out regular visits to vulnerable and socially isolated seniors to monitor their well‑being.
Volunteer Development
  • Recruit, interview and screen potential volunteers.
  • Establish networks with local community-based services/resources, such as grassroots, social services, corporate organisations and schools, to engage volunteers to help run or assist in the programmes.
  • Provide and coordinate orientation of volunteers to their assigned role and the mission and objectives of the AAC.
  • Serve as the key communication link between the AAC and its volunteers.
